Lucas Ocampos was one of the Sevilla players who broke lockdown rules by organising a party during the lockdown. Despite that, another video has caused more problems for Ocampos: he threw the mask on the floor after the derby, once again breaking the rules.

Nobody doubts Lucas Ocampos' footballing quality. He is a magnificent player for Sevilla and he scored the first goal after the corona break. However, you have to question his capability of sticking to the rules and health warnings. He was one of those who broke lockdown rules by organising a party and now he has caused himself a problem again after the derby. 

The Argentine player ended up being substituted during the game against Betis and he went to the stands with the rest of his teammates. He sat there, had his mask on and keep his distance. That was fine. 

However, when the referee blew the final whistle, Ocampos went down to the pitch to celebrate with his teammates. Surprisely, when he went down the stairs, he took his mask off and and threw it down to the floor. 

Then, once he was on the pitch, he jumped on De Jong and hugged him without respecting social distancing at all. His face even made contact with his teammate's. It remains to be seen whether La liga take action given it is not his first offence.
